Maryland | Perspective

Politicians

Maryland’s four Declaration signers are remembered by the schoolchildren’s mnemonic “Carroll Chased Paca with a Stone”: Charles Carroll of Carrollton, Samuel Chase, William Paca, and Thomas Stone. All held important public offices, with Paca serving as three-time governor. There was an inherent contradiction in these men: signatories of a document proclaiming liberty and equality while among Maryland’s largest enslavers. A slave census for Carroll’s Doughoregan Manor in Howard County enumerates more than 300 enslaved individuals.
